technical shit: this is anti-ghosting. Keyboards without diodes have a matrix problem where holding multiple keys means it becomes impossible to determine what keys are pressed: to avoid incorrect keys being pressed, it just ignores both the incorrect and correct keypresses

the way you solve this is by either:1. being clever with how your matrix works. this technically leaves anti-ghosting issues but you can at least limit how often they happen, and on one key combinations. 2. PUT FUCKING DIODES IN YOUR DESIGN YOU CHEAPASS PUNKS

the thing is, there's several keyboard designs where they are not clever with their matrixes.Here's a fucking hint: modifier keys like ctrl, alt, shift, windows? they will commonly be pressed ALONG WITH letter keys. PUT THEM ON DIFFERENT COLUMNS YOU PUNKS

this is merely a fundamental problem with making keyboard matrixes and we've understood how to fix it basically since the first day we started making keyboard matrixes
(DIR) Post #AoYF5dd78A6SEIZ6J6 by foone@digipres.club
2024-11-30T00:16:41Z
0 likes, 1 repeats
diodes are about a cent each in bulk.adding them to a keyboard increases the cost by about a dollar. it's required for them to work correctly, but apparently there's a large market for 1$ cheaper but broken keyboards
